This impacts on their capacity to produce and provide services.<\/p>\n<p>According to the <a href=\"https:\/\/news.un.org\/en\/story\/2022\/05\/1117832\">UN<\/a>, current approaches to land management may threaten half of the world\u2019s estimated US$44 trillion of economic output.<\/p>\n<p>Latin America is one of the areas most affected by land degradation. The United Nations Convention to Combat Desertification (UNCCD) <a href=\"https:\/\/www.unccd.int\/convention\/regions\/annex-iii-latin-america-and-caribbean-lac\">describes<\/a> the region as being caught in a \u201cvicious circle of land overexploitation, degradation, increased demands on production, greater poverty, food insecurity and migration\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>Despite this, restoration technologies and strategies exist, which aim to prevent the erosion of still-productive areas, and even recover what has been lost. A number of governments and organisations across Latin America are already testing and pursuing such initiatives, including governance plans for the restoration of millions of hectares of land, campaigns for agriculture that is less dependent on chemical inputs, and the promotion of regenerative land management practices.<\/p>\n<h2>Land degradation in Latin America<\/h2>\n<p>Land degradation is a change in the health of the soil that results in a decrease in its productive capacity, commonly caused by bad practices. According to the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.unccd.int\/resources\/global-land-outlook\/overview\">UNCCD<\/a>, there are more than 2 billion hectares of degraded land in the world, of which 14% is in Latin America.<\/p>\n<p>Most of the degraded land in the region is affected by <a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/agriculture\/can-gran-chaco-deforestation-food\/\">deforestation<\/a> and overgrazing. The main areas of cropland under pressure are in northeastern Brazil, the Gran Chaco \u2013 the biome that spans northern Argentina, Paraguay and Bolivia \u2013 and central Chile, among others, according to the UNCCD.<\/p>\n<blockquote><p>We have a very serious problem, with millions of hectares degraded \u2013 an immense loss of natural capital<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>Walter Vergara leads <a href=\"https:\/\/initiative20x20.org\/\">Initiative 20&#215;20<\/a>, a regional project that aims to restore 50 million hectares by 2030, bringing together governments, private investors and technical organisations, and covering most Latin American countries. It was launched in 2014 and is already working on more than 100 projects on 23 million hectares across the region, in both restoration and soil conservation.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cAt the regional level we have a very serious problem, with millions of hectares degraded \u2013 an immense loss of natural capital,\u201d said Vergara, explaining that this is due to bad agricultural and forestry practices, surface mining and \u201cpoorly thought-out infrastructure construction\u201d.<\/p>\n<p>To address this, the initiative pursues six strategies: natural or assisted reforestation; agroforestry; grassland restoration through sustainable livestock management; silvopasture \u2013 the integration of trees, forage and grazing animals; low-carbon agriculture through sustainable practices; and conservation of what has not yet been degraded.<\/p>\n<h2>Restoration in Chile<\/h2>\n<p>In 2015, the UNCCD <a href=\"https:\/\/knowledge.unccd.int\/publications\/latin-america-makes-headway-against-land-degradation\">agreed<\/a> to combat desertification and restore land with national targets based on the level of erosion in each country, aiming to achieve Land Degradation Neutrality (LDN) by 2030.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_46224\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-46224\" style=\"width: 400px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/uncategorised\/46221-chile-seeks-to-guarantee-water-rights-amid-severe-drought\/\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-46224\" src=\"https:\/\/dialogue.earth\/content\/uploads\/2021\/09\/chile-drought-scaled.jpg\" alt=\"chile drought\" width=\"400\" height=\"267\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-46224\" class=\"wp-caption-text\"><strong>Read more: <a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/uncategorised\/46221-chile-seeks-to-guarantee-water-rights-amid-severe-drought\/\">Chile seeks to guarantee water rights amid severe drought<\/a><\/strong><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Chile, a country that has been <a href=\"http:\/\/dialogue.earth\/en\/uncategorised\/46221-chile-seeks-to-guarantee-water-rights-amid-severe-drought\/\">hit by drought<\/a> for over a decade, is one that is moving forward with a national strategy for the restoration of degraded lands. This was created by a participatory and federal process, as Emilia Undurraga, an agronomist and the country\u2019s Minister of Agriculture until March, explained to Di\u00e1logo Chino.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e problem of erosion in Chile is profound: about 80% of the country has some degree of risk of degradation and about 20% is at high or very high risk of desertification,\u201d she explained, adding that the country\u2019s midland Central Zone is the most affected by both drought and fires, having seen significant changes in land use due to human activities.<\/p>\n<p>In this context, Chile developed its <a href=\"https:\/\/mma.gob.cl\/content\/uploads\/2021\/11\/Plan-Nacional-de-Restauracion-de-Paisajes-2021-2030.pdf\">national plan for landscape restoration<\/a> between the ministries of agriculture and environment, and published in late 2021. The plan, Undurruga said, \u201chas very concrete goals\u201d, such as the restoration of 1 million hectares by 2030.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t is not only about restoring what has been lost, but also about finding a way to protect the land with better governance, increased state capacities, specific financing and strategies for prevention, and reduction of degradation factors, with the participation of public, private, civil society and university actors,\u201d said Undurraga.<\/p>\n<h2>Agroecology in Argentina<\/h2>\n<p>After decades of intensive agriculture, livestock farming and changes in land use, degradation is all too evident in Argentina. According to its environment ministry\u2019s 2020 <a href=\"https:\/\/www.argentina.gob.ar\/sites\/default\/files\/iea_2020_digital.pdf\">report<\/a> on the state of the environment, of Argentina\u2019s total land area of 270 million hectares, 100 million hectares are affected by erosion, with an estimated rate of increase of about 2 million hectares per year. The planting of one or two crops without rotation \u2013 notably <a href=\"http:\/\/dialogue.earth\/en\/agriculture\/44411-is-argentinas-soy-boom-over\/\">soybeans<\/a> \u2013 overgrazing and the advance of the agricultural frontier are among the factors that have contributed to this.<\/p>\n<p>Beatriz Bonel, an agronomist specialising in soil sciences at the National University of Rosario, explained that the three basic aspects of soil \u2013 its physical, chemical and biological condition \u2013 have been impacted in Argentina, with land suffering from a shortage of nutrients, compaction and loss of organic matter.<\/p>\n<div class='block--pullout-stat block--pullout-stat--float cd-shortcode--factbox'>\n                <p class='block--pullout-stat__title'>What is agroecology?<\/p>\n                <div class='block--pullout-stat__content'>\n                    <br \/>\nAn approach that applies ecological principles to agricultural production, aiming to reduce its environmental impacts. Practices include crop diversification, use of biological over chemical inputs, and conservation tillage, among many others<br \/>\n\n                <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<p>\u201cThere are technologies to slow down some processes and reverse others, and there is also a generational change with new actors. Young people are coming in with a different mentality that incorporates environmental variables,\u201d she explained.<\/p>\n<p>One of these new actors Bonel refers to is the Network of Municipalities for Agroecology (<a href=\"http:\/\/www.renama.org\/\">RENAMA<\/a>), a group created in 2016 and that now brings together 40 Argentine localities and 200 producers who work across more than 100,000 hectares, all with an agroecological approach. Agronomist Eduardo Cerd\u00e1, one of its founders, stressed the importance of promoting a shift towards an \u201cemancipatory\u201d production model that decouples producers from the dollarised costs of agrochemicals and seeds. \u201cAgroecology is a paradigm where balance and health take precedence,\u201d he added.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e must not forget that in the last 20 years, 100,000 small and medium-sized producers have been lost in Argentina,\u201d he said, indicating that many have been unable to compete with industrial-scale agribusiness, and some have seen their land become unproductive.<\/p>\n<h2>Regenerative agriculture in Brazil<\/h2>\n<p>The Adapta Sert\u00e3o initiative is a coalition of organisations promoting environmental regeneration strategies for small farmers in the semi-arid Sert\u00e3o region, Brazil\u2019s northeastern \u201coutback\u201d and one of the driest areas of the country.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_49222\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-49222\" style=\"width: 400px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/uncategorised\/49186-what-is-regenerative-agriculture-food-systems-soil\/\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-49222\" src=\"https:\/\/dialogue.earth\/content\/uploads\/2021\/12\/DAD430-1-scaled.jpg\" alt=\"cows in a green meadow\" width=\"400\" height=\"267\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-49222\" class=\"wp-caption-text\"><strong>Read more: <a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/uncategorised\/49186-what-is-regenerative-agriculture-food-systems-soil\/\">Explainer: What is regenerative agriculture?<\/a><\/strong><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Daniele Cesano, director of the Adapta Group, explained that soil erosion is a serious problem in several areas of Brazil, and is mostly caused by the extensive agricultural model. \u201cWe are facing a very accelerated process of erosion and desertification. Our response is regenerative agriculture, which avoids monoculture and seeks to diversify,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p>The menu of tools they use with small producers includes agroforestry systems and improvements in soil fertility through cover crops and biological fertilisers. Added to this are management, knowledge and financing: \u201cWe want to professionalise the work, we want producers to be informed and trained. We want to move from input agriculture to management and process-led agriculture. This is the best way to take care of the soil,\u201d Cesano added.<\/p>\n<h2>Projects in the Gran Chaco<\/h2>\n<p>The <a href=\"http:\/\/dialogue.earth\/en\/climate-energy\/53415-opinion-financial-sector-curb-gran-chaco-deforestation\/\">Gran Chaco<\/a> is one of the largest and most threatened forest regions in Latin America. A project managed by the Argentine conservation-focused ProYungas Foundation, in alliance with the Argentine Association of Direct-Seeding Producers (AAPRESID) and the Bertoni Foundation of Paraguay, seeks to promote a sustainable, deforestation-free soybean supply chain based on two axes: good agricultural practices and the conservation and restoration of native vegetation.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_50124\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-50124\" style=\"width: 400px\" class=\"wp-caption alignleft\"><a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/agriculture\/can-gran-chaco-deforestation-food\/\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-50124\" src=\"https:\/\/dialogue.earth\/content\/uploads\/2022\/01\/Deforestacio\u0301n_Chaco_Cre\u0301dito_Marti\u0301n_Katz_Greenpeace_2-scaled.jpeg\" alt=\"aerial view of a bulldozer deforesting in the Gran Chaco, in Chaco, Argentina.\" width=\"400\" height=\"267\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-50124\" class=\"wp-caption-text\"><strong>Read more: <a href=\"http:\/\/stage.dialogochino.net\/en\/agriculture\/can-gran-chaco-deforestation-food\/\">Can the Gran Chaco halt deforestation and provide food?<\/a><\/strong><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Alejandro Brown, president of ProYungas, said that it is necessary to establish \u201cbetter land planning\u201d to improve livestock farming practices that integrate grazing and production with forest cover, known as silvopasture.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e start from the concept of a protected productive landscape, a model of land management on a landscape scale that integrates production with conservation and ecosystem services, in a context of environmental and social sustainability,\u201d Brown explained.<\/p>\n<p>Given its experience with in-field experimentation, AAPRESID is contributing to the project\u2019s methodology, helping producers to collaborate with scientists on sustainable production models. The actions will be carried out in five pilot sites in the Gran Chaco, covering an area of some 50,000 hectares.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>In a region hard hit by land
